jQuery Pinch Zoom:让你的网页触摸体验更上一层楼
jQuery Pinch Zoom:让你的网页触摸体验更上一层楼
在移动互联网时代,用户体验的提升已经成为各大网站和应用的重中之重。特别是在移动设备上,触摸操作的流畅性和便捷性直接影响用户的满意度。今天,我们来聊一聊一个非常实用的jQuery插件——jQuery Pinch Zoom,它可以让你的网页在移动设备上实现类似于原生应用的缩放效果。
什么是jQuery Pinch Zoom?
jQuery Pinch Zoom是一个基于jQuery的JavaScript插件,它允许用户通过双指捏合(pinch)来放大或缩小网页内容。这种功能在移动设备上非常常见,比如在查看图片、地图或文档时,用户可以轻松地调整视图大小。该插件的设计初衷是模仿iOS和Android设备上的原生缩放功能,使网页的交互体验更加自然和直观。
如何使用jQuery Pinch Zoom?
使用jQuery Pinch Zoom非常简单。首先,你需要在你的HTML文件中引入jQuery库和该插件的JavaScript文件:
<script src="jquery.min.js"></script>
<script src="jquery.pinchzoom.min.js"></script>
然后,你可以对你希望启用缩放功能的元素进行初始化:
$(document).ready(function() {
$('.zoomable').pinchZoom();
});
这里,.zoomable
是你的目标元素的类名。初始化后,用户就可以通过触摸屏上的双指操作来缩放这个元素了。
应用场景
-
图片查看器:在图片库或相册应用中,用户可以使用jQuery Pinch Zoom来放大图片查看细节。
-
地图应用:在地图服务中,用户可以缩放地图以查看更详细的区域信息。
-
电子书阅读器:电子书应用可以利用此功能让用户更舒适地阅读文本。
-
在线文档:在线文档编辑器或查看器可以使用此功能来放大文本或图表。
-
游戏:一些移动游戏可以使用此功能来提供更丰富的用户交互体验。
优点与注意事项
jQuery Pinch Zoom的优点在于:
- 易于集成:只需几行代码即可实现复杂的触摸交互。
- 跨平台兼容:适用于iOS和Android设备。
- 用户友好:提供类似于原生应用的体验,提升用户满意度。
然而,使用时也需要注意:
- 性能:在复杂的网页上,频繁的缩放操作可能会影响性能。
- 兼容性:虽然大多数现代浏览器支持,但仍需考虑旧版浏览器的兼容性。
- 用户指导:有时用户可能不熟悉这种操作,需要提供适当的指导或提示。
总结
jQuery Pinch Zoom为网页开发者提供了一种简单而有效的方法来增强移动设备上的用户体验。通过模仿原生应用的触摸缩放功能,它让网页的交互更加自然和直观。无论是图片查看、地图浏览还是文档阅读,jQuery Pinch Zoom都能让你的网页在移动设备上脱颖而出。希望通过本文的介绍,你能对这个插件有更深入的了解,并在实际项目中灵活运用,提升用户的触摸体验。